Forward received emails to a recipient on the Infomaniak Webmail app
This guide explains how to forward one or more already received emails to a recipient, by placing them either…
- … in the body of a new message directly,
- … as an attachment (this allows you to forward the entire message with its headers and not just its content).

Configure the default forwarding method
You can configure Mail Infomaniak so that an email (forward) is always forwarded as an attachment and not quoted in the body of the message.
Indeed, by default the original email will be quoted in plain text directly in the body of the email:
To change this and set the default forwarding method:
- Click here to access the Infomaniak Web Mail app (online service ksuite.infomaniak.com/mail).
- Click on the Settings icon at the top right.
- Click on Sending in the secondary sidebar menu.
- Click on the desired option ("As an attachment" ) to "Transfer emails":

From now on, the original email will be attached as an attachment to the email:
